#2c7985 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2c7985 is composed of 17.3% red, 47.5%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.9% cyan, 9%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 188.1 degrees, a saturation of 50.3% and a lightness of 34.7%. #2c7985 color hex could be obtained by blending #58f2ff with #00000b.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

Shades and Tints of #2c7985

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f1f9f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#2c7985

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#555b5c is the less saturated color, while #0397ae is the most saturated one.
